Stockholm Business School (SBS) is one of the largest departments at Stockholm University with 140 employees and about 3,500 students per academic year. We conduct outstanding research and teaching in an open and innovative environment. Teaching and research is focused on accounting, finance, management and marketing.

After a break due to the pandemic, the 2020 Inauguration of New Professors and Conferment of Doctoral Degrees can finally be held. The inauguration of professors and the conferment of doctoral degrees are the foremost among the common academic traditions at universities and higher education institutions in Sweden. Both date from the Middle Ages.
